Overview of the Guitars
The ADM Full Size Classical Nylon Strings Acoustic Guitar is priced at $139.99, while the Jasmine S34C NEX Orchestra-Style Cutaway Acoustic Guitar is slightly cheaper at $139.00. Both guitars are designed for beginners and provide essential accessories to help new players get started. The ADM model leans towards classical styles with nylon strings, while the Jasmine offers a more versatile acoustic experience with its grand orchestra body.
Design and Build Quality
The ADM Full Size Classical Nylon Strings Acoustic Guitar features a solid spruce top, which is known for producing a rich and bright sound. It has a beautifully constructed body that allows for a balanced tone and enhanced resonance. On the other hand, the Jasmine S34C has a select spruce top with Jasmine’s Advanced “X” Bracing, which is designed to enhance volume and sound clarity. Both guitars are well-made, but the Jasmine's Venetian cutaway design gives it an edge in playability, particularly for accessing higher frets.
Sound Quality
When comparing sound quality, the ADM guitar offers a softer tone due to its nylon strings, making it suitable for beginners or those focusing on classical music. The Jasmine S34C, equipped with phosphor bronze strings, delivers a more powerful projection and a clearer sound, catering to a variety of musical styles. This difference in string type and construction makes the Jasmine potentially more versatile for players exploring different genres.
Playability
In terms of playability, the Jasmine is designed with a slim nato neck and a 25.5” scale length, which provides a comfortable grip and smooth playing experience. The ADM guitar also emphasizes ease of play, with a dual-action truss rod that helps balance neck tension. However, the Jasmine’s design specifically enhances playability by allowing effortless access to higher frets, which can be a significant advantage for advancing players.
Included Accessories
Both guitars come bundled with essential accessories to facilitate learning. The ADM Full Size Classical model includes a gig bag, digital tuner, footstool, capo, polish cloth, and a one-month free lessons card. In contrast, the Jasmine S34C offers a gig bag, tuner, strap, extra strings, picks, an instructional DVD, and a polishing cloth. While both packages are comprehensive, the Jasmine's inclusion of an instructional DVD adds significant value for beginners seeking guidance.

Which should you buy?
Ultimately, choosing between the ADM Full Size Classical Nylon Strings Acoustic Guitar and the Jasmine S34C NEX Orchestra-Style Cutaway Acoustic Guitar depends on your specific needs and preferences. If you are interested in classical music and require a softer tone with nylon strings, the ADM guitar is a solid choice. Conversely, if you prefer versatility, enhanced sound clarity, and a comfortable playing experience, the Jasmine S34C stands out with its design and additional instructional materials. Both guitars are excellent starter options, but the Jasmine may provide more value for those looking to explore different musical styles.
